Princeton's WordNet

  1. exasperating, infuriating, maddening, vexingadjective

    extremely annoying or displeasing

    "his cavelier curtness of manner was exasperating"; "I've had an exasperating day"; "her infuriating indifference"; "the ceaseless tumult of the jukebox was maddening"

Wiktionary

  1. infuriatingadjective

    Extremely annoying, frustrating or irritating

ChatGPT

  1. infuriating

    Infuriating refers to making one extremely angry or impatient; causing intense annoyance or irritation. It often involves an action or behavior that provokes a strong feeling of resentment and frustration.
